There is no limitation on the number of international students who can decide to reside in the UK upon completion of their degree.
Changes have also been made on the post-study work visa, meaning students can now stay in the UK after completing their degree, although there are certain criteria’s to achieve before this becomes possible, one of which is, upon completing your studies, individuals would be required to switch from a Tier 4 Visa to a Tier 2 General Visa. Application for a work visa from the Border of the United Kingdom Agency is also required, options are also made available, depending on your employment status after graduating, and these options include:
- Tier 2 (General) Visa – these are available to recent graduates with a recognized Bachelor’s, Master’s or PhD degree from a university in the United Kingdom, with proof of a job offer from a licensed employer willing to pay a salary not less than £20,800.
- Tier 1 Entrepreneur Visa – these are open to students who are developing a groundbreaking idea with the backing and sponsorship of their university.

Free Tuition in the Uk
The most viable means through which to study for free in the United Kingdom is by acquiring a scholarship. Providing qualifications are being met and eligibility criteria are being fulfilled, there are various scholarships which can offset living expenses, travel costs and full fee waivers. Listed below are five scholarships which can help achieve this:
- Clarendon Fund Scholarships at the University of Oxford: The scholarship offered by this institution covers the entire tuition fees along with a grant which would offset the full living cost while studying at the University of Oxford. The Clarendon fund makes available over 100 new scholarships every year for degree courses for every international student.
- Commonwealth Scholarship and Fellowship Plan: This scholarship is solely for students applying from India, applicants are only to do a one-year master’s degree or a three-year doctorate degree. The selection for eligible applicants for this scholarship is carried out in India by the Ministry of Human Resource Development.
- Gates Cambridge Scholarship: This is a prestigious scholarship awarded by the University of Cambridge to every international student seeking to pursue a full-time postgraduate degree at the University.
- Goa Education Trust Scholarship: Another scholarship which is only eligible for Indian nationals with an Indian passport, the scholarship on offer covers tuition fees for a master’s degree in universities in the UK while also making provision for living expense up to £25,000.
- Rhodes Scholarships at the University of Oxford: This scholarship is among the oldest scholarships awarded in the world, they are postgraduate scholarships awarded to outstanding students. A class consisting of 89 students is selected annually from limited countries.

General Tuition
For international students applying to British universities, the tuition fee of the university depends on the chosen program of study by the applicant. For classroom-based programs, the fees are usually pegged at £14,096 annually, while for Laboratory-based programmes tuition fees are a bit steeper as they are often around £16,222 per each academic year. Clinical programs require tuition fees of £21,767 and, MBA programmes are pegged at £18,914.
